Key Trends Shaping the iGaming Industry in 2024

Several major trends are influencing the direction of iGaming this year. Understanding these can help operators anticipate market demands and enhance player engagement.

1. Integration of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

AI and machine learning are revolutionizing iGaming by enabling personalized gaming experiences, fraud detection, and smarter customer support. Operators use AI to analyze player behavior and tailor game recommendations, bonuses, and promotions accordingly.

2. Expansion of Live Dealer Games

Live dealer games continue to gain popularity as they combine the convenience of online play with the social interaction of a physical casino. Enhanced streaming technology and real-time interaction make these games more engaging than ever.

3. Mobile-First Gaming Experiences

With the majority of players accessing games via smartphones and tablets, mobile optimization remains a priority. Developers focus on creating responsive designs and lightweight apps that deliver seamless gameplay on any device.

Innovations Driving Player Engagement

Beyond trends, specific innovations are helping operators capture and retain player interest. These include:

  • Gamification: Incorporating elements like leaderboards, achievements, and missions to increase player motivation.
  • Cryptocurrency Payments: Offering faster, more secure transactions through Bitcoin, Ethereum, and other digital currencies.
  •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R): Creating immersive environments that replicate real-world casino experiences.
  • Social Gaming Features: Enabling players to interact, compete, and share achievements within the gaming community.

Regulatory Landscape and Compliance Challenges

As the iGaming market expands globally, regulatory frameworks are becoming more complex. Operators must navigate licensing requirements, anti-money laundering (AML) policies, and responsible gaming mandates to ensure compliance and build trust with players.

Global Regulatory Overview

iGaming Regulatory Highlights by Region (2024)
Region Licensing Authority Key Regulations Recent Updates
Europe UK Gambling Commission, MGA Strict player protection, AML, advertising rules Enhanced verification processes, tighter bonus restrictions
North America Various State Regulators State-specific licenses, age verification New states legalizing online gaming, increased taxation
Asia-Pacific Varies by country Limited markets, focus on offshore licensing Emerging markets exploring regulation, crackdown on illegal operators
Latin America Local regulators Growing legalization, consumer protection New frameworks in Brazil and Colombia

Strategies for Success in the Competitive iGaming Market

To thrive in 2024, iGaming operators should adopt a multi-faceted approach that balances innovation, compliance, and player satisfaction.

Focus on User Experience

Providing intuitive interfaces, fast loading times, and responsive customer support enhances player retention. Personalization through AI-driven insights also improves engagement.

Leverage Data Analytics

Data-driven decision-making enables operators to optimize marketing campaigns, identify trends, and detect fraudulent activities early.

Invest in Security Measures

Robust cybersecurity protocols protect player data and maintain platform integrity, fostering trust and loyalty.

Expand Payment Options

Offering diverse payment methods, including e-wallets and cryptocurrencies, caters to a broader audience and simplifies transactions.
